    Seth D.

    I left a glowing review 5 years ago, but unfortunately I have to update things. Happy Star has changed hands and at first the change in many recipes was actually quite good imo. The sauce on the chicken and broccoli was different, yet just as good if not better. My only complaint was that with each order, something was left out of our bag. First 2 times was a white rice box, third time was egg rolls, (I learned to check the bag and caught most issues after this). Obviously not a good look but I figured they were growing pains of the new owners. Now, the quality of the food has gotten terrible. We ordered last night and there's virtually no sauce on my chicken broccoli, and my wife's fried shrimp have gone from large plump pink shrimp, to tiny, overcooked, brownish smelly and ugly shrimp (by comparison). The shrimp used to overflow a box carton and a half-quart(?) container of sweet and sour was included. Now it's a quarter of sauce and the shrimp has likely been halved in quantity. Also, the drive home had a strong smelly shrimp smell to it, which never happened over the 10 years with the previous owners, (likely using older shrimp now). In short, our food was quite terrible, even by the new owner's standard set when they first opened. You guys are going to lose all the loyal clients at this rate. The old owners were clearly highly dedicated and their food quality was impeccable. I've come to happy Star since it opened 10 or so years ago, but we may have to seek out an alternative, which is sad.

    Charles B.

    Happy star is a small place located in a very small strip mall. Inside is mostly closed up do to covid so we order carry out. It seems to be run by a very nice family as we see the same people each time we go in. While the outside is nothing to look at, the food is excellent. Excellent and rich flavor. Large portions. Plenty of options. Our favorite is the szechuan tofu. Of all the chinese places in Reynoldsburg, happy star is one of the best.
